第四步 接著參照第三步為剛才的層添加“Hide”事件,并且將行為設(shè)置為“OnMouseOut”,這樣鼠標(biāo)拿開(kāi)時(shí)就可以隱藏該層了。
完成上述操作之后,按下“F12”按鈕即可打開(kāi)IE瀏覽器進(jìn)行預(yù)覽,當(dāng)鼠標(biāo)移動(dòng)到這個(gè)圖片上的時(shí)候會(huì)出現(xiàn)預(yù)先設(shè)置好的提示字樣,而鼠標(biāo)移開(kāi)圖片時(shí)字樣自動(dòng)隱藏。
自動(dòng)調(diào)整窗口大小
有些網(wǎng)頁(yè)在改變窗口大小的時(shí)候也會(huì)隨之調(diào)整網(wǎng)頁(yè)頁(yè)面大小,因此窗口過(guò)大就不會(huì)有空白處,窗口過(guò)小邊緣就不會(huì)跑出移動(dòng)條,對(duì)于這種自動(dòng)調(diào)整頁(yè)面大小的功能,在Dreamweaver MX 2004中可以參照下述步驟來(lái)很容易的實(shí)現(xiàn)。
第一步 新建一個(gè)頁(yè)面,然后通過(guò)“Insert→Table”命令插入一個(gè)一行三列的表格,此時(shí)可以先不管它的寬度,而是通過(guò)下述設(shè)置讓它自動(dòng)伸展適合瀏覽器窗口。
第二步 這時(shí)可以看見(jiàn)每個(gè)單元格下部都標(biāo)明了寬度且有一個(gè)小三角形(如圖3)。在這個(gè)表格中,可以設(shè)定哪部分是需要固定的,不過(guò)只能讓一列自動(dòng)伸展,比如此處我們?cè)O(shè)定最后一列隨著窗口大小的變化自動(dòng)伸展。
第三步 選中最后一列,運(yùn)行“View→Table Mode→Layout Mode”命令,并且在彈出的菜單中選擇“Make Column Autostrach”一項(xiàng)(如圖4)。
第四步 接著將出現(xiàn)對(duì)話框,并且會(huì)提示為了能夠使行伸展,Dreamweaver需要放置一些間隔圖片在其它列中,在此選擇“Create a spacer image file”一項(xiàng),這樣圖片在瀏覽器窗口不會(huì)顯示出來(lái),而是起著固定表格的作用。
第五步 確認(rèn)之后返回原先的編輯窗口,可以看見(jiàn)最后一列已經(jīng)自動(dòng)伸展填充了整個(gè)瀏覽器窗口,而另外兩列則保持著固定的寬度。
提示:設(shè)定自動(dòng)伸展的列可以在列上端看見(jiàn)一個(gè)波浪線。
完成上述操作之后,在IE瀏覽器中預(yù)覽頁(yè)面效果的時(shí)候,如果改變窗口的大小,則最后一列的寬度也會(huì)隨之變化,而前兩列的寬度維持不變,這樣就可以實(shí)現(xiàn)自動(dòng)調(diào)整窗口大小了。
上文介紹的僅僅是Dreamweaver MX 2004中行為功能的一些方法,靈活地把行為和圖層結(jié)合運(yùn)用還可以實(shí)現(xiàn)諸如動(dòng)態(tài)圖片、可拖拽的圖層等等功能,讓你的主頁(yè)看起來(lái)更加豐富多彩!